Suggest a better descriptionSoak wooden skewers in water for 30 minutes. Prepare medium-hot grill. Combine cumin and salt and press evenly onto both sides of pork rib chops. Add mix of vegetables and fruit to each skewer.
Grill chops and kebobs for 12 to 15 minutes, turning to brown. Brush with honey barbecue sauce during final 5 minutes of cooking.
Serve with white rice.
